  1. This was a fun race despite the rain, cold and impending thunderstorms!   They also chose a long race (dock start to C/3, upwind to Ft Adams,  downwind to 13 (RG just N of bridge), back upwind to Ft Adams, then DDW to finish.

    The first leg was a reach to C and Relentless with their big genoa beat us by one boat length but we had a better rounding and immediately got 5 boat lengths in the lead.  We made a tactical error by tacking in and letting them continue towards the dumplings.  We were close at the first Ft Adams rounding but on the long downwind to 13 we really extended our lead.

    The wind on the final upwind leg was that “punchy gusts” really strong gust (24 app.) for 3-5 seconds then it lets up.   A single port tack until we close to the lay line for Ft Adams light.  And again, Relentless went much farther and make up some time.  Final leg was DDW and we were able to extend our leader to be the line winner and even with correction we beat Relentless.

    As usual,  we were Afarat-ed once again – we beat them by 17:54 and they corrected over us by 2:56.
